What are the responsibilities and job description for the Caregiver position at The Cardellis Group LLC?
The Caregiver is a paraprofessional member of the care team who would work directly under the supervision and direction of the Registered Nurse (RN) and provides various services for the client. The majority of which would be personal care and activities of daily living.
Qualifications
Must be at least eighteen (18) years of age and have a minimum of a High School Diploma. Must have at least one year of experience in the healthcare profession preferred. Must have NA listing. Must have, at minimum, one (1) satisfactory reference from previous employers.
Must display good emotional care and be able to physically tolerate much standing, bending, stooping, and heavy lifting within guidelines and teaching provided by the state of North Carolina.
Must be able to read, follow written instructions and document the care given.
Should demonstrate flexibility in acceptance of assignments and a cooperative attitude toward providing services. Must meet all agency requirements.
General Responsibilities
1. In home care agency - performs only under supervision of a Registered Nurse, who has provided written instructions for client care (Home Care Plan).
2. Assists client in all activities of daily living/hygiene assistance, bathing, grooming, linen changes, and so forth. As documented in the Plan of Care.
3. Prepares nutritious meals within the client’s diet and assists client with eating when necessary.
4. Assists clients with transfers, ambulation and exercises under guidelines of the RN or PT when warranted and documented in POC.
5. Performs light housekeeping chores, which facilitates client’s self-care in the home.
6. Assists client in bathroom, with the use of the bedpan and performs incontinence care.
7. Answers client’s calls and attends to their requests promptly.
8. Meets the safety needs of the client and uses equipment safely and properly.
9. Completes records and carries out all assignments as required.
10. May not be assigned to receive or reduce to writing orders from a physician.
11. Notifies DON of any acute or pertinent changes in a client’s condition
12. Communicates availability to work to the coordinator on a weekly basis or as requested.
13. Maintains confidentiality regarding the client’s condition and his/her family, with the exception of the Agency.
14. Performs all skills and procedures competently and within. The regulations and licensing laws of the state, Agency policies, and other applicable federal and state laws.
